Cómo se crean las máquinas tragamonedas: desde la idea hasta el lanzamiento
La máquina tragamonedas moderna es una síntesis de matemáticas, psicología, arte e ingeniería. La tragaperras exitosa debe complacer visualmente, sonar «en carácter», pagar honestamente dentro de la RTP declarada y trabajar impecablemente en la pila HTML5 móvil. A continuación, una hoja de ruta desde la primera idea hasta el lanzamiento comercial.
1) Idea y Recurch: por qué el mundo otra ranura
Objetivo: encontrar un producto claro-promesa (fantasy-aventura? ¿retro-neón? ¿Mecánica de clústeres?) y el ancla del mercado.
Pasos:- Análisis de tops por proveedores, mecánicos (modelos Megaways/Cluster/Hold & Spin/Crash/Book), mercados y estacionalidad.
- Descomposición de referentes: ciclo de emociones, frecuencia fich, ganancia media, ritmo de giros «vacíos».
- Dock de lanzamiento en 1-2 páginas: línea fantasy, mecánica UTP, volatilidad objetivo, posicionamiento y KPI.
Salida: corto Game Pitch + métricas de alto nivel (RTP, volatilidad, tasa de éxito objetivo, tasa de bonificación).
2) Matemáticas: el corazón de la ranura
Opciones clave:- RTP (Retorno al jugador): proporción de apuestas devueltas a los jugadores de larga distancia (generalmente 94-97% según el mercado).
- Volatilidad: varianza de las ganancias (baja = frecuente, pequeña; alto = raro, grande).
- Hit Frequency: la probabilidad de cualquier ganancia por vuelta (por ejemplo, 1 de 3,5).
- Cycle Length: longitud condicional del ciclo estadístico de equilibrio de fich/jackpot.
- Bonus Frequency & Contribution: cuán a menudo y qué proporción de RTP dan los bonos/freespins/feature buys.
- Max Exposure: el máximo teórico de pago (x cap de apuesta).
- Diseño de la tabla de pagos, escalas de caracteres, strips reel/pesos para clústeres.
- Simulación de bonificaciones (multiplicadores, sticky wilds, multipliers progresivos, respins).
- Balance: Distribuimos RTP por «piscinas»: juego base, friends, fiches, jackpots.
- Las simulaciones de Monte Carlo (≥10^8 giros) → un informe sobre distribuciones, colas, series length.
Salida: Math Sheet (pesos, tablas, cálculo de RTP, tolerancias, seed para QA) + simulaciones.
3) Diseño de juego y bucle UX
Bucle de emociones: espera → micro recompensa → tensión creciente → clímax → descarga.
Legibilidad: valores grandes, cuadrícula clara (5 × 3/6 × 4/7 × 7), mínimo ruido en la zona «fría».
Tempo: «rápido/normal/turbo» sin pérdida de transparencia.
Ficha: una mecánica «heroica» + 1-2 de soporte para no rociar RTP.
Buy Feature: pensar en el precio, el impacto en RTP y los límites por jurisdicciones (a veces prohibido).
Disponibilidad: control de una mano, fuentes ≥14 -16 px, modos para daltónicos, fibras de vibro.
4) Dirección de arte y sonido
ADN visual: mudboard, paleta, fuente, estilo de símbolo (premium/basic), animación de ganancia.
Pantallas clave: lobby, escena principal, pantalla de giros gratis/bonificación, tabla de pagos, reglas.
Sonido: banda sonora temática (loupetle sin fatiga), pistas de audio en win/near-miss, silenciando en modos «silenciosos».
Optimización: sprite/texture atlases, compresión (WebP/AVIF), lazy-loading.
5) Pila de tecnología
Cliente: HTML5/Canvas/WebGL (motores: propio/Phaser/Pixi), TypeScript.
RNG: generador criptográficamente resistente en el servidor o «origen» de cliente certificado + validación de servidor.
Servidor: Node/Go/Java, API sin estado, auditoría de registros, límites/tiempos de espera.
Ensamblaje/DevOps: CI/CD, snapshots de bills, fichflags, observabilidad (lógica, métricas FPS/latency).
Integración: RGS (Remote Game Server) ↔ RTP-Host Casino a través de adaptadores (protocolos GS, wallets, free rounds API).
6) Seguridad y honestidad
RNG-aislado: almacenamiento seed/nonce, anti-manipulación, registros inmutables (WORM/merkle hashes).
Antifraude: protección contra aceleradores, auto-clics, reemplazo de temporizador; rate-limits, replay-guard.
Protección del cliente: ofuscación, verificación de integridad, firma de arte/script, anti-tamper.
Juego responsable: límites de apuesta/tiempo, realidad de las ganancias (discordancia de margen), «reality checks».
7) Botes y grupos externos
Esquemas: local fijo, local progresivo, red progresiva (multi-casino), mystery-jackpot.
Contabilidad: proporción de la apuesta → grupo; capas/flora; cascada de niveles (Mini/Major/Grand).
Riesgos: sincronización de grupos, resistencia a la frecuencia de activación, auditoría.
8) Monetización y métricas
Apuesta y denominación: líneas/coins/multiplicadores, apuestas automáticas con pasos seguros.
KPI del productor: GGR/NGR, ARPU/ARPPU, retención de D1/D7/D30, cheque medio, frecuencia fich,% buy feature, FPS/CRASH técnico.
Orientado al jugador: promedio de ganancias, puntuación de éxito, longitud de la serie seca, tiempo hasta el primer bono.
9) Pruebas y QA
Unit/integration: «semillas» deterministas para reproducir escenarios.
Math-QA: comparar simulación y referencia RTP, tolerancias de frecuencia, colas de distribución.
Carga: usuarios en línea pico, degradación de la red (3G/RTT alto).
Dispositivos cruzados: Android/iOS/escritorio, diferentes DPI/relaciones de aspecto, WebKit/Chromium.
Pruebas UX: legibilidad, claridad de reglas, ergonomía.
Retroceso: artefactos, pausa/devoluciones a la sesión, rebile del cliente - guardar el estado.
10) Certificación y cumplimiento
Pruebas de laboratorio: matemáticas, RNG, lógica, sostenibilidad, conformidad con las técnicas de las jurisdicciones.
Paquete Dock: math sheet, fuentes del generador, tabla de pagos, logs de simulaciones, hyde por fichas, versionando artefactos.
Jurisdicciones: varían según los mínimos de RTP, función de compra, giros automáticos, velocidades y revelaciones.
Cambios de versión: cualquier edición de matemáticas → re-certificación.
11) Localización y adaptación cultural
Textos/UI: idiomas, monedas, formato de números/tiempo, discleimers legales.
Contenido: símbolos/historias dentro de los límites de la sensibilidad local; códigos de color.
Pago: métodos locales (cuando corresponda - a través del casino), límites de apuestas.
Marketing: etiquetas/iconos/pancartas por temporada (playoffs deportivos, vacaciones).
12) Integración con el casino y lanzamiento
Distribución: integraciones directas, agregadores, mercados de proveedores.
Fichas de casino: torneos, misiones, rondas libres, misiones - API desafíos para incluir en el metu.
Escaparate: bolas/vídeos, etiquetas (novedad, bote, alta volatilidad).
Canario: soft-launch por 1-3% de tráfico, telemetría, guardrails por crash-reat/latency/quejas.
13) Post-lanzamiento: analítica y long-ran
Dashboards: retención, frecuencias de fich, profundidad de las sesiones, mapas de series «secas», retroalimentación de sapport.
Equilibrio sin cambios: ajustes UX, velocidad de giro, pistas, sonido/efectos.
Eventos: skins de temporada, torneos temáticos (no cambiar matemáticas).
Reinicio de contenido: remaster light (arte/sonido), continuación de IP (parte 2) con éxito.
14) Ética y Juego Responsable por Diseño
Reglas claras y probabilidad de ganar, ausencia de "boosts' engañosos.
Recordatorios suaves de tiempo/gasto, límites de fácil acceso y «pausa».
Ausencia de «patrones oscuros»: temporizadores ocultos, animaciones obsesivas después de perder.
Disponibilidad: subtítulos, contraste, control sin sonido/vibro.
15) Hojas de cheques
Productor
- Pitch + UTP + referencias
- Objetivos RTP/volatilidad/tasa de éxito/exposición máxima
- Roadmap de contenido y marketing
Matemático/analista
- Math Sheet con Sims ≥10^8 giros
- Balance de RTP por piscina (base/bono/bote)
- Informes sobre las colas y la serie length
Diseño de juego/Arte/Sonido
- Stylgide, Animática, Malla SFX
- Legibilidad y control de tempo
- Optimización de conjuntos
Ingeniería
- RNG-aislado, lógica, anti-tamper
- CI/CD, fichflags, telemetría
- Rendimiento de dispositivo cruzado
QA/Cumplimiento
- Math-QA vs referencia RTP
- Carga/degradación de la red
- Paquete de certificación
Comercio/Distribución
- Integraciones (agregadores/directos)
- Free rounds/torneos/misiones
- Soft-launch + guardrails
La creación de una ranura es una ingeniería guiada de emociones: matemáticas precisas, mecánica clara, arte expresivo y sonido, plataforma confiable y cumplimiento impecable. Los equipos que mantienen un equilibrio entre novedad y legibilidad, crecimiento y responsabilidad reciben juegos duraderos, algo que tanto jugadores como operadores valoran por igual.